Summary

This trial aims to see if improving ankle movement can help people with knee pain perform squats better. Participants will do exercises to increase ankle flexibility and then test their knee function.

Who is the study for?
This trial is for women aged 18-59 with Patellofemoral Pain lasting at least 6 months, who haven't had clinic treatments in that time. They must have limited ankle movement (<45 degrees on a lunge test) and no knee swelling, abnormal limb structures, severe resting pain, or past surgery/fractures affecting leg/spine biomechanics.
What is being tested?
The study examines how limited ankle flexibility affects single-leg squats in those with knee pain. Participants will either receive 'Mobilization with Movement' therapy or just education without mobilization to see which method better improves squat performance.
What are the potential side effects?
Since the interventions involve physical therapy techniques and educational components rather than medication, side effects are minimal but may include temporary discomfort or muscle soreness from the movements performed during the sessions.

The most common treatments for Patellofemoral Pain Syndrome (PFPS) focus on biomechanical corrections through physical therapy exercises, orthotic devices, and taping techniques. Physical therapy aims to strengthen the quadriceps, improve hip and core stability, and enhance flexibility in the hamstrings and calf muscles, which helps correct patellar tracking and reduce knee joint stress. Orthotic devices and taping improve foot alignment and reduce abnormal forces on the knee. These treatments are essential for PFPS patients as they address the underlying biomechanical issues, leading to more effective and sustained pain relief.
